Technical field
The utility model relates to field of switches, and more particularly, it relates to a kind of novel point driving switch.
Background technology
Push-button switch refers to and utilizes button to promote transmission mechanism, makes moving contact and fixed contact drive and realize the switch of circuit changing-over by on-off.It is that relative motion by movable contact spring and static contact realizes that moving contact and fixed contact are opened by on-off, but push-button switch uses for a long time, movable contact spring and static contact are back and forth opened by on-off, can make static contact produce distortion, affecting movable contact spring is connected with static contact, cause push-button switch loose contact, reduce push-button switch useful life.
Utility model content
The deficiency existing for prior art, the purpose of this utility model is to provide a kind of novel point driving switch, has the static contact of making not yielding, the feature of high life.
For achieving the above object, the utility model provides following technical scheme: a kind of novel point driving switch, comprise switch base, switch cover, movable contact spring, for driving the transmission mechanism of movable contact spring swing and controlling the button of transmission mechanism, described switch base and switch cover are fastened and connected mutually, described transmission mechanism is placed in switch base and switch cover forms in cavity volume, button is placed in the button groove that switch cover offers, described switch base comprises switch base body, binding post, binding post comprises the static contact of binding post main body and one bending and molding, described static contact is provided with fixed part successively, connecting portion, contact site, described fixed part and the riveted joint of binding post main body are fixing, described switch base body is provided with the swinging chute for placing movable contact spring, described swinging chute both sides are equipped with the mounting groove for binding post is installed, described binding post main body is placed in mounting groove, described contact site is provided with brace rod corresponding thereto, one end face of brace rod is inclined to set and is inconsistent with the contact site of static contact, described brace rod and switch base body are wholely set.
By adopting technique scheme, binding post is arranged in mounting groove by binding post main body, static contact riveted joint is fixed in binding post main body, being placed in movable contact spring in swinging chute swings to static contact, static contact is connected with movable contact spring, because described contact site is provided with brace rod corresponding thereto, one end face of brace rod is inclined to set and is inconsistent with the contact site of static contact, when movable contact spring contacts with contact site, described brace rod can produce a support force to static contact, this support force can balance out the power that movable contact spring produces static contact, prevent static contact distortion, improve useful life.
The utility model is further set to: described brace rod quantity is two and is disposed on mounting groove lateral wall.Described brace rod quantity be two support contact site can be more reliable and more stable, can not make contact site banking be out of shape.
The utility model is further set to: the cross section of described swinging chute is horn-like, and upward, the width of horn-like little openend is greater than the thickness of movable contact spring to horn-like large openend.The cross section of described swinging chute is horn-like, and movable contact spring, in swing process, can not be offset, and more stablely realizes movable contact spring and is connected with static contact or disconnects.
The utility model is further set to: the mounting groove sidewall at brace rod place is provided with draw-in groove, and the connecting portion of described static contact coordinates with the clamping of draw-in groove phase.Described connecting portion coordinates with the clamping of draw-in groove phase, can prevent that static contact from moving, and makes static contact and movable contact spring keep good contact.

Embodiment
Referring to figs. 1 through Fig. 4, a kind of novel point driving switch of the utility model is described further.
A kind of novel point driving switch, comprise switch base 1, switch cover 2, movable contact spring 3, for driving the transmission mechanism 4 that movable contact spring 3 swings and controlling the button 5 of transmission mechanism 4, described switch base 1 is fastened and connected mutually with switch cover 2, described transmission mechanism 4 is placed in switch base 1 and forms in cavity volume with switch cover 2, button 5 is placed in the button groove that switch cover 2 offers, described switch base 1 comprises switch base body 11, binding post 12, binding post 12 comprises the static contact 122 of binding post main body 121 and one bending and molding, described static contact 122 is disposed with fixed part 1221, connecting portion 1222, contact site 1223, described fixed part 1221 is fixing with 121 riveted joints of binding post main body, described switch base body 11 is provided with the swinging chute 111 for placing movable contact spring 3, described swinging chute 111 both sides are equipped with the mounting groove 112 for binding post 12 is installed, described switch base body 11 is placed in mounting groove 112, described contact site 1223 is provided with brace rod 113 corresponding thereto, one end face of brace rod 113 is inclined to set and is inconsistent with the contact site 1223 of static contact 122, described brace rod 113 is wholely set with switch base body 11, binding post 12 is arranged in mounting groove by binding post main body 121, static contact 122 riveted joints are fixed in binding post main body 121, being placed in the interior movable contact spring 3 of swinging chute 111 swings to static contact 122, one end face of described brace rod 113 is inclined to set and is inconsistent with the contact site 1223 of static contact 122, when movable contact spring 3 contacts with contact site 1223, described brace rod 113 can produce a support force to static contact 122, this support force can balance out the power that movable contact spring 3 produces static contact 122, prevent that static contact 122 is out of shape, improve useful life.
Described brace rod 113 quantity are two and are disposed on mounting groove 112 lateral walls, described brace rod 113 quantity be two support contact site 1223 can be more reliable and more stable, can not make contact site 1223 banking be out of shape.
The cross section of described swinging chute 111 is horn-like, the width of horn-like little openend is greater than the thickness of movable contact spring 3, horn-like large openend upward, its cross section can be also circular arc, but the cross section of described swinging chute 111 is horn-like, movable contact spring 3, in swing process, can not be offset, and the more stable movable contact spring 3 of realizing is connected with static contact 122 and disconnects.
Mounting groove 112 sidewalls at brace rod 113 places are provided with draw-in groove 1121, the connecting portion 1222 of described static contact 122 coordinates with draw-in groove 1121 phase clampings, described draw-in groove 1121 width are greater than static contact 122 width, preferably large 0.5MM is optimal selection, draw-in groove 1121 degree of depth are also greater than static contact thickness, be convenient to described connecting portion 1222 and coordinate with draw-in groove 1121 phase clampings, can prevent that static contact 122 from moving, make static contact 122 and movable contact spring 3 keep good contact.
